Ticket: sign-off needed on the Lexbundle string-extraction script update. It now catches pluralized keys and skips commented-out markup, which fixed the phantom entries in last week's export. Heads up for contractors: run it from the repo root or paths break. Before merging, we need written approval from the maintainer identified below.

named custodian: Brivan Eliath Quenox Frador

☐ Verify the Lumenpay integration suite before sealing the signing keys. The settlement tests against the Karvel sandbox have been flaky all week — reviewers should confirm the retry wrapper in `settle_batch_spec` actually masks the timeout rather than hiding a real regression. Do not proceed with the ceremony until three consecutive green runs are logged. Once confirmed, the ceremony officer unlocks the escrow laptop, and the recovery passphrase for the Lumenpay escrow key is recorded directly below this item.

strongbox words: wenix-ulador

## Payroll Export Recovery — Ledgerfall v4 Format

After the v4 format change, old export credentials were invalidated. If the payroll export account is locked, request recovery through the Ledgerfall ops console rather than re-creating the account; re-creation breaks downstream mappings at Brindlepoint Finance. Select "restore service account," confirm the v4 schema flag, and wait for the integrity check to pass. The console then asks for the recovery passphrase on file, which is:

vault phrase of hahop-badug = novvan-ulaion-zorius-noviel-gorwyn-casix-tamys

Turnover on these units has fallen for four consecutive quarters, and carrying costs now exceed projected recovery value. Finance has modeled the impact under conservative and moderate scenarios; neither threatens covenant compliance. Marta Ilvesen's team will present disposal options, including bulk liquidation through regional resellers, at the November session. The board should weigh this against our broader positioning for next year, summarized below.

confidential, kagup-bafog: Fraaxax Group is in early talks to buy Soroxox Group for about $343.8 million. The Olidor launch date is June 14, and nothing goes to the press before then. Legal wants the Aldmirek Logistics term sheet signed before July 23.